Reason #1: Your Branding Feels Outdated or Undefined

First impressions matter, and your brand is your salon’s personality. If your logo looks like it’s from a different decade, your salon’s interior doesn’t match your online vibe, or you haven’t clearly defined your unique style, you’re missing out. Outdated or inconsistent branding can make your salon seem less professional, less trendy, or simply less appealing to your ideal clientele. In an industry driven by aesthetics, a tired brand speaks volumes – and not in a good way.

Reason #2: Your Online Presence is Inconsistent or Non-Existent

We’re living in a digital-first world. Potential clients are searching online, scrolling social media, and reading reviews before they ever pick up the phone or walk in. If your Google My Business profile is incomplete, your social media posts are sporadic, or your website is difficult to navigate (or even worse, non-existent!), you’re essentially invisible. An inconsistent online presence sends mixed messages and makes it hard for clients to find you, trust you, or understand what makes your salon special. Lack of engaging content means even if they find you, there’s nothing compelling to keep them interested or inspire them to book.

Reason #3: Lack of Engaging, Conversion-Focused Content

You might be posting pictures of pretty nails, but are those posts actually driving bookings? Many salons focus on simply “showing” rather than “telling” and “converting.” If your social media strategy lacks:

  • Clear Calls to Action (CTAs): Telling clients what to do next (e.g., “Book Now,” “DM for availability”).
  • Variety and Interactivity: Beyond just static images, are you using Reels, Stories, polls, and engaging questions?
  • Value-Driven Information: Are you offering nail care tips, explaining benefits, or showcasing the unique experience of your salon?

Without these elements, your content becomes background noise. It might get a few likes, but it won’t fill your appointment book.
